Questa è una domanda piuttosto ampia e francamente, quora non è un posto per ottenere una vera risposta. Hai bisogno di leggere un libro/fare un corso o due. Come ho spiegato nella mia risposta sto cercando di imparare un po' di programmazione, ma c'è qualcosa di tecnico che dovrei sapere prima di iniziare, per esempio come funzionano le parti di un computer?
Posso pensare a due libri che sarebbero perfetti per te da considerare:
- il primo libro che ti consiglierei di iniziare è di un ex-IBMer di oltre 30 anni chiamato: "How Do It Know" ISBN-13: 978-0615303765 che è certamente un buon punto di partenza. e come il prossimo libro di Jon, una lettura facile ed estremamente accessibile.
- Si è scoperto che ho un altro amico che è un veterano di oltre 40 anni del 'settore', Jon Steinhart. Jon è un mio amico e collega di lunga data che ha appena finito un libro che si rivolge a persone che si pongono domande come questa, chiamato "The Secret Life of Programs: Understand Computers - Craft Better Code" ISBN-13: 978-1593279707. Sono stato onorato di essere un recensore durante il processo di scrittura. Inizia con la logica dei computer e porta il lettore attraverso tutto ciò che lei/lui ha più o meno bisogno/voluto capire ad un livello base (come il suo editore mi ha descritto quando mi ha chiesto di recensirlo per loro, il libro che ogni insegnante di scuola superiore dovrebbe avere sul suo scaffale per essere in grado di indicare le menti desiderose quando la gente fa domande). Per citare una recensione: "Molti dettagli tecnici sono disponibili online, ma non sono organizzati o raccolti in un posto conveniente. ... l'ingegnere veterano Jonathan E. Steinhart esplora in profondità i concetti fondamentali che sono alla base della macchina. Soggetti come l'hardware del computer, come il software si comporta sull'hardware, così come il modo in cui le persone hanno risolto i problemi utilizzando la tecnologia nel corso del tempo."
In entrambi i casi - prendi alcuni libri ben consigliati e inizia a leggere. Penso che CS sia un argomento affascinante ma difficilmente qualcosa che può essere facilmente o completamente descritto bene in pochi paragrafi.
Buona fortuna.